About this map

The Payette National Forest high country dominates this mid-1970s survey, showing a landscape defined by seasonal alpine access and forest management. At the heart of the area, Paddy Flat serves as a central hub, anchored by the Paddy Flat Forest Service Station and the nearby Paddy Flat Campground. This region was vital for early forest service operations and summer recreation, with a network of pack trails and jeep trails connecting remote water bodies like Louie Lake and the Kennally Lakes.
